Dense bodies and Langerhans granules after application of podophyllum resin.

L Olmos.   

Abstract

The application of an alcoholic solution of podophyllum resin at concentrations above 10% for seven hours on guinea-pig udders increases the number of dense intracytoplasmic bodies in the Langerhans cells localized in the epidermis. A close relationship can be established between these inclusions and the typical Langerhans granules in view of the numerous intermediate forms with features of one or the other. Serial sections of these structures confirm the irregularity not only of the lysosome-like bodies but also of the Langerhans granules, which may be fusiform or oblong or even present two vesicular dilatations, one at each end of the rod.
